Description
Ukuya is a platform for building community-based solutions for companies, universities, professional networks, and volunteer communities. The system helps organizations digitize workflows, improve communication, collect data, build user communities, and launch solutions for HR, learning, CRM, job portals, alumni networks, volunteer matching, supply chain, logistics, finance, and e-commerce. The core product idea is software built around people, their roles, relationships, and shared activities.
Task
The platform had to support different organization types and business scenarios while remaining flexible and fast to customize for each client. Key technical challenges included a complex role model, multiple community types, user relationships, configurable workflows, high notification volume, third-party integrations, fragmented data, and the need to launch new modules without breaking existing ones. The API required stronger security, stable authorization, audit trails, and protection of users’ personal data.
Solution
Designed the backend as a modular platform with configurable roles, permissions, user profiles, groups, relationships, workflows, and notifications. Split the business logic into clear domains: community management, HR, learning, CRM, job portal, volunteer projects, data collection, and reporting. Added queues and background jobs for heavy operations, plus configurable entities and extensible APIs for client-specific deployments. Strengthened security with validation, access control, audit logs, and stricter personal data handling.
Results
The platform became easier to deploy for different client types, including corporate teams, learning communities, alumni networks, and professional associations. New workflows and modules could be launched faster, communication and statuses became more transparent, and manual community management work was reduced. The system gained a more reliable backend foundation for scaling, integrations, and further development of community features.
